

PLYMOUTH, Mich.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Schwartz Investment Counsel, Inc. (the Firm), the investment adviser for the Ave Maria Mutual Funds and the Schwartz Value Focused Fund, has announced a reduction in the management fee of three funds effective May 1, 2022. The management fee of the Ave Maria Focused Fund (AVEAX) will be lowered from 0.85% to 0.75% per year, bringing the total expense ratio down to 1.12%. The Ave Maria World Equity Fund (AVEWX), will lower its management fee from 0.95% to 0.75% per year, reducing the total expense ratio to 1.02%. Also, the Schwartz Value Focused Fund (RCMFX) will reduce its management fee from 0.95% to 0.75% per year, resulting in a 1.26% total expense ratio. George P. PLYMOUTH, Mich.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--The Texas Pacific Land Corporation (TPL) Board of Directors has refused to act on an advisory ballot proposal approved by 55.9% of shareholders. Despite the majority vote held on December 29, 2021, to declassify the Board of Directors, the Board has not taken action to do so. Schwartz Investment Counsel, Inc., on behalf of clients, owns over 74,000 shares of TPL (approximately 1% of the shares outstanding) with a market value more than $96,000,000. Having invested in TPL since 2015, Schwartz Investment Counsel, Inc. is one of TPL’s largest shareholders and believes TPL’s board has a fiduciary obligation to implement the owners’ wishes. Schwartz Investment Counsel, Inc. believes doing so would clearly be in the best interest of the company and all its shareholders. TPL currently has three classes of board members. If declassified, all directors would be required to stand for re-election yearly. Currently, only one-third of the board members stand for re-election each year. Schwartz Investment Counsel, Inc. is against staggered boards and believes they only serve to entrench board members, which is not in the best interest of all shareholders. On December 29, 2021, Schwartz Investment Counsel, Inc., along with the majority of shareholders, voted to declassify, which the TPL Board has refused to do. PLYMOUTH, Mich.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Schwartz Investment Counsel, Inc., a registered investment adviser established in 1980 and manager of the Ave Maria Mutual Funds, has announced the launch of its newest fund, the Ave Maria Focused Fund (Ticker: AVEAX) effective May 1, 2020. The Fund is registered with the Securities Exchange Commission as a non-diversified investment company (a mutual fund). The Ave Maria Focused Fund will invest in companies believed by the Adviser to offer high earnings growth potential with a goal of long-term capital appreciation. The portfolio will be comprised of companies of all sizes and the managers may invest a substantial portion of its assets in a small number of issuers, industries, or business sectors, in essence, a concentrated portfolio. The fund will use the same moral screens as the other Ave Maria Mutual Funds. The lead portfolio manager of the fund is Chadd M. Garcia, CFA, and the co-manager is Adam P. Gaglio, CFA.
